Ramesh Choudhary

Ramesh Choudhary

Jaipur, Rajasthan

Ramesh learned traditional block printing techniques from his father at the age of ten. Today, he leads a workshop of 12 artisans who create textiles using hand-carved wooden blocks and natural dyes.

Each piece Ramesh creates takes several days to complete, with patterns that have been passed down through generations. He specializes in Bagru and Sanganer printing techniques.

Lakshmi Devi

Lakshmi Devi

Kutch, Gujarat

Lakshmi comes from a long line of Ajrakh artisans, a craft that has been in her family for over six generations. She uses natural indigo dyes and traditional block printing methods to create intricate patterns on fabric.

Lakshmi's printing process is entirely done by hand, from preparing the dyes using local plants and minerals to stamping each pattern with precision and care. Her work preserves the ancient Ajrakh tradition.

Vijay Sharma

Vijay Sharma

Maheshwar, Madhya Pradesh

Vijay is a master handloom weaver who has been working with traditional looms for over 25 years. He specializes in Maheshwari weaving, known for its distinctive borders and fine cotton-silk blend.

Using techniques that date back centuries, Vijay creates lightweight, breathable fabrics with geometric patterns and vibrant colors. Each piece takes several days to complete on his wooden handloom.
